Cybersecurity Vulnerabilities in Digital Ecosystems
The technical mechanisms behind such leaks often involve sophisticated methods including:
Credential stuffing attacks utilizing compromised password databases
Social engineering tactics targeting personal account recovery processes
Exploitation of security gaps in cloud storage synchronization services
Malware deployment for screen capture and data extraction purposes
These vulnerabilities highlight the ongoing arms race between digital security professionals and malicious actors seeking to exploit personal information for various motives.

Preventive Measures and Digital Protection Strategies
Individuals in prominent public positions can implement several protective measures to reduce vulnerability to privacy breaches:
Employing comprehensive two-factor authentication across all digital accounts
Utilizing encrypted cloud storage solutions with zero-knowledge architecture
Regular security audits of personal and professional digital footprints
Establishing clear protocols for account recovery and incident response
These strategies, while not foolproof, represent important steps in maintaining digital sovereignty in an increasingly interconnected world.
